<Objectives> The classification of cells in the CAPD drainage is important as an index for the early diagnosis of peritonitis in peritoneal dialysis patients. The automated hematology analyzer XE-5000 can be used to measure body cavity fluid samples in the body fluid cavity mode. The aim of this study is to examine the utility of XE-5000 for the classification of cells in the CAPD drainage. <Methods> From August 2014 to December 2016, we collected 87 CAPD drainage samples. We examined the correlation between XE-5000 and the manual method for classifying mononuclear cells, polymorphonuclear cells, and mesothelial cells. <Results> A significant correlation was found between XE-5000 and the manual method for mononuclear cells and polymorphonuclear cells. The correlation between XE-5000 and the manual method for mononuclear cells and polymorphonuclear cells tends to be strong because there was a high measurement cell count by XE-5000. On the other hand, no correlation was found for mesothelial cells. <Conclusions> Our data suggest that the correlation between XE-5000 and the manual method was approximately good. Although it is important to set a practical configuration to add the manual method as needed, XE-5000 seems to contribute to labor saving in the test, and results on the classification of cells in the CAPD drainage are rapidly obtained using XE-5000 as a screening test.
